Unable to Launch FC 24 due to faulty(?) anticheat

Product: EA SPORTS FC 24
Platform:PC
Please specify your platform model. EA app - PC
AMD or Nvidia Model Number N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 Ti
Enter RAM memory size in GB 16
Which mode has this happened in? Practice Mode
How often does the bug occur? Every time (100%)
Steps: How can we find the bug ourselves? By reviewing dump files for anticheat
What happens when the bug occurs? A popup screen appears to say there is error code E0670A01 and there is a hardware error. It usually appears twice and sometime the FC 24 splash screen is displayed before the second popup. The game never starts as anticheat crashes and returns to the EA Desktop
What should be happening instead? The game should be launched

This problem has been ongoing for over 4 weeks now and I have involved Support from HP, Microsoft and EA. The EA support has pointed me to self help guides on the EA Help site but none of these resolve the issue.

FC24 was working fine until about 4 weeks ago, at this point the E0670A01 message started appearing

  • The OS has had the following done to it:
    • Clean boot
    • Reinstall preserving Apps and files
    • Complete fresh install of Windows 11 23H2
    • New factory build install of Windows 11 21H2 - Errors on this and after updating to current version
  • The hardware has had the following done to it:
    • Replacement Graphic card
    • Replacement Wifi and Bluetooth
    • Replacement SSD (hence Factory build install)

Despite all these actions the one constant is the E0670A01 error from anticheat. HP have had the PC twice for repair but the error persists.

All signs say Hardware error but HP are unable to find one, they have stressed the machine with the Heaven Graphics benchmark but that shows no issues. I don't know how useful that is as it's based on DirectX 11 and FC24 is DirectX 12. However the error occurs before the game is launched so not clear this is a graphics problem.

It's not an account issue as I can run FC 24 on a laptop and anticheat allows the game to launch, the spec of the laptop means it is unplayable but it proves the account is OK.

Basically there is some incompatibility between my PC and EA anticheat that was introduced just over a month ago. Have there been changes to anticheat in that time, if there have is there any way to use the previous version to confirm whether it is anticheat causing the problem?

If this is a real hardware issue (that HP can't detect) is there any further information Anticheat can provide on what hardware check/operation was being performed at the time the error occurred?

The bottom line is I can't prove it's a hardware error if HP can't find it. If your anticheat is finding something tangible I can take this problem back to HP and get them to focus on the hardware area being checked when anticheat fails.

The dump files I've tried to attach seem to have anticheat accessing areas of memory it doesn't have access to so this could be a bug or could be invalid data being returned from a hardware interface.  I'm unable to attach .dmp or .zip files, so how do I attach dumps?
